Beyond the Quirk: Exploring the Unforgettable Designs of My Hero Academia's Pro Heroes

In the vibrant, often chaotic world of My Hero Academia, where superpowers known as 'Quirks' define society, it's easy to get lost in the thrilling battles and compelling character arcs. Yet, a crucial, often unsung hero of the series is its incredible character design, particularly for the seasoned Pro Heroes.

These aren't just costumes; they're extensions of their wearers' Quirks, personalities, and fighting styles, making them as iconic as the heroes themselves. Let's dive into some of the most brilliantly conceived Pro Hero designs that captivate fans worldwide.

First, we have Hawks, the fastest Pro Hero.

His design masterfully blends casual cool with lethal efficiency. The sleek, aerodynamic jacket, the simple visor, and his signature red wings aren't just for show. Each feather is a precise weapon and communication device, highlighting his strategic mind and incredible speed. His look embodies freedom and precision, making him instantly recognizable and utterly unique.

Mirko, the Rabbit Hero, is a powerhouse of design.

Her muscular physique isn't hidden but celebrated, emphasizing her raw strength and agility. The rabbit motif is fierce, not cute, with sharp, almost predatory ears and a powerful silhouette that screams 'don't mess with me'. Her outfit is practical for intense close-quarters combat, allowing for maximum mobility and impact, perfectly reflecting her no-nonsense attitude.

Then there's Eraser Head (Shota Aizawa), whose design is a testament to understated practicality.

Eschewing flashy colors for tactical gear, his capture weapon and iconic goggles are his defining features. This look perfectly complements his stealthy, pragmatic fighting style and his Quirk-nullifying ability. It's a design that says 'professional', focusing on function over flair, making him one of the most beloved and visually distinct heroes.

Fat Gum stands out with his incredibly unique, bulky, yellow design.

His costume directly reflects his Quirk, which allows him to absorb impacts and store kinetic energy. Despite his large frame, his design suggests surprising agility, making him a memorable and visually humorous yet formidable presence. He’s a walking, talking embodiment of his own power.

Gang Orca pushes the boundaries of 'humanoid' hero design.

His imposing, orca-themed costume is both intimidating and majestic. Sharp lines, deep blues and blacks, and an undeniable marine aesthetic make him feel like a force of nature. He's a powerful reminder that heroes come in all shapes and sizes, and his design instantly conveys his formidable aquatic prowess.

Best Jeanist brings haute couture to the superhero world.

His denim-themed outfit, complete with high collars and intricate stitching, is a marvel of fashion-meets-functionality. It elegantly showcases his ability to manipulate fibers, turning an everyday material into a weapon. His design is sophisticated, powerful, and utterly unique, proving that heroism can be stylish.

Endeavor, the Flame Hero, burns with intensity.

His fiery aesthetic, constantly emanating flames, is both a visual spectacle and a functional aspect of his costume. It perfectly encapsulates his overwhelming power and his driven, often volatile, personality. His design is a stark, powerful representation of his Quirk and his internal struggles.

And of course, All Might, the Symbol of Peace.

His Prime form is the quintessential superhero — bold, classic, inspiring with vibrant colors and a powerful silhouette. The stark contrast with his weakened form, gaunt and deflated, powerfully conveys the immense toll of his heroism and the sacrifices he has made, making both designs equally iconic and emotionally resonant.

Midnight, the 18+ Hero, boasts a design that's both alluring and strategically effective.

Her skin-tight suit, distinctive mask, and whip hint at her sleep-inducing Quirk while maintaining a professional, if unconventional, heroic persona. It's a design that plays with expectations, making her visually intriguing and impactful.

Finally, Present Mic electrifies the screen with his loud, flamboyant, rockstar aesthetic.

From his spiky blonde hair to his shades and speaker-like collar, every element screams 'sound hero'. His design is a perfect visual representation of his booming vocal Quirk and energetic personality, making him unforgettable.

My Hero Academia's Pro Hero designs are more than just costumes; they are integral parts of the storytelling, reflecting character, Quirk, and role.

They are a testament to the incredible artistry and thoughtful planning that goes into creating a truly immersive and iconic anime universe, making each hero not just powerful, but unforgettable.
